Plenary speakers for the Nineteenth International Scientific Conference „Contemporary Materials 2026“

17.07.2026.



The Nineteenth International Scientific Conference „Contemporary Materials 2026“ is going to be held, under the organization of Academy of Sciences and Arts of Republic of Srpska, on September 10 and 11. 2026 in Banja Luka.

The co-organizers of the conference are the Serbian Academy of Sciences and Arts (Serbia), Alma Mater Europaea and Technical University in Gabrovo (Bulgaria)

The work of the Conference is going to be held within four symposium: Symposium A is dedicated to the science of matter condensed matter and physics of solid state. Symposium B to the biomaterials and nanomedicine. Symposium C to the water and the new symposium D to the environmental and sustainable materials. The papers are going to be presented through the plenary lectures and poster session.
